If you bargain the rate down to $22,000 initially, and then state your trade-in, you could end up getting a rate under the supplier's reduced end of $20,000. Lots of auto salesmen have actually set sales objectives for completion of every month and quarter. Plan your check out to the supplier near these schedule times, and you may get a far better deal or additional cost savings if they still require to reach their quota.


After you've discussed the last car rate, ask the supplier regarding any deals or programs you get approved for or state any type of you found online to bring the rate down even extra. Mentioning saying the right points, don't tell the dealership what month-to-month settlement you're trying to find. If you want the finest deal, start settlements by asking the dealer what the out-the-door price is.


FYI: The price tag isn't the overall cost of the cars and truck it's simply the supplier's recommended list price (MSRP). Keep in mind those taxes and charges we stated you'll have to pay when buying a cars and truck? Those are included (on top of the MSRP) in what's called the out-the-door price. So why bargain based on the out-the-door rate? Dealerships can expand financing payment terms to strike your target monthly payment while not reducing the out-the-door price, and you'll wind up paying more rate of interest over time - first year of ford explorer.

Both you and the dealer are qualified to a fair deal however you'll likely finish up paying a little even more than you want and the dealership will likely get a little less than they want. Always start settlements by asking what the out-the-door price is and go from there. If the dealer isn't going reduced sufficient, you might be able to work out some specific items to obtain closer to your desired price.


It's a what-you-see-is-what-you-pay kind of rate. https://lwccareers.lindsey.edu/profiles/4540598-cody-smith. Simply because you've discussed a bargain does not indicate you're home-free yet. You'll likely be provided add-on choices, like fancy technology bundles, interior upgrades, prolonged guarantees, gap insurance coverage and various other security plans. Ask on your own if the add-on is something you truly need prior to concurring, as the majority of these offers can be added at a later date if you pick.

If you make a decision to purchase an add-on, negotiate that cost, also. Lenders might require space insurance coverage with brand-new automobiles, however you do not have to fund it through the dealership. Purchase it from your auto insurance policy company or look around for rates. Cars are a major acquisition, and you don't intend to regret getting one prep work is key! Compare vehicle costs around your location and constantly work out based on the out-the-door price.


The wholesale price is what suppliers pay for utilized automobiles at auction. Wholesale price drops typically come before retail rate stop by 6 to 8 weeks. A rate decline is constantly a great sign for pre-owned auto customers. Prior to you begin doing the happy-car-shopper dance, keep in mind the market is still challenging.


Interest prices, typically higher for used car financings than new car fundings, are progressively rising. In other words, if you fund a used auto, the month-to-month payments will be greater currently than a year ago.

You might hesitate to buy a secondhand auto from a private vendor (sometimes referred to as peer-to-peer) if you never ever acquired in this manner before.


We'll describe why listed below. There are a lot more unknowns in a peer-to-peer (P2P) purchase. Nevertheless, getting an auto peer-to-peer via Autotrader's Personal Seller Exchange (PSX) can get rid of several of the view it now unknowns and conserve you time. A strong reason for buying peer-to-peer is because the seller has the cars and truck you desire at a reasonable rate.


Moreover, an exclusive vendor doesn't need to cover the overhead costs a dealer creates. A dealer is really a middleman in the deal, creating the needed revenue by inflating the acquisition rate when offering the cars and truck. At the end of the day, the peer-to-peer bargain will only be as great as the customer's negotiating skills.
